Battle Harbour Lor, Nf vs Tshane Climate & Distance Between

Botswana flag
  • The distance between Battle Harbour Lor, Nf, Canada and Tshane, Botswana is approximately 11,294 km or 7,019 mi.
  • To reach Battle Harbour Lor, Nf in this distance one would set out from Tshane bearing 322.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Battle Harbour Lor, Nf bearing 294.5° or WNW .
  • Battle Harbour Lor, Nf has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Tshane has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• Battle Harbour Lor, Nf is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Tshane is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 20.4 °C (36.7°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.9 °C (12.4°F) more in Battle Harbour Lor, Nf.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 656.9 mm (25.9 in) more which is equivalent to 656.9 l/m² (16.12 US gal/ft²) or 6,569,000 l/ha (702,270 US gal/ac) more. About 3 2/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.3° lower in Battle Harbour Lor, Nf than in Tshane.
